# Todoist MCP Server
A comprehensive Model Context Protocol (MCP) server for the Todoist API. Provides full access to tasks, projects, labels, sections, and comments with support for all task properties including priorities, due dates, labels, subtasks, and more.
## Features
- **Complete Task Management**: Create, read, update, delete, complete, and reopen tasks
- **Full Task Properties Support**: Content, description, due dates (natural language or specific), priority (1-4), labels, duration estimates, subtasks, assignees, and more
- **Project Management**: Create and manage projects with colors, hierarchies, and view styles
- **Label Management**: Create and organize labels for cross-project task categorization
- **Section Management**: Organize tasks within projects using sections
- **Comment Management**: Add and manage comments on tasks and projects
- **Rate Limiting**: Built-in rate limit handling (450 requests per 15 minutes)
- **Error Handling**: Comprehensive error handling with meaningful error messages
## Installation
### Prerequisites
- Node.js (v18 or higher)
- npm
- A Todoist account with API token
### Get Your Todoist API Token
1. Log in to your Todoist account
2. Go to Settings → Integrations → Developer
3. Copy your API token
4. Set it as an environment variable: `TODOIST_API_TOKEN`
### Install the Server
```bash
# Clone or download this repository
cd todoist-mcp
# Install dependencies
npm install
# Build the project
npm run build
```
## Configuration
### For Claude Desktop
Add this to your Claude Desktop configuration file:
**macOS**: `~/Library/Application Support/Claude/claude_desktop_config.json`
**Windows**: `%APPDATA%\Claude\claude_desktop_config.json`
```json
{
"mcpServers": {
"todoist": {
"command": "node",
"args": [
"E:\\my drive\\programs and files\\dev\\todoist MCP\\build\\index.js"
],
"env": {
"TODOIST_API_TOKEN": "your_api_token_here"
}
}
}
}
```
Replace the path with your actual installation path and add your Todoist API token.
### For Other MCP Clients
Set the `TODOIST_API_TOKEN` environment variable and run:
```bash
node build/index.js
```
## Available Tools
### Task Management
#### `list_tasks`
Get all active tasks with optional filtering.
**Parameters:**
- `project_id` (optional): Filter by project
- `section_id` (optional): Filter by section
- `label` (optional): Filter by label name
- `filter` (optional): Custom filter string (e.g., 'today', 'p1', 'overdue')
- `lang` (optional): Language code for filter parsing
**Example:**
```json
{
"filter": "today",
"project_id": "2203306141"
}
```
#### `get_task`
Get a single task by ID with all properties.
**Parameters:**
- `task_id` (required): Task ID
#### `create_task`
Create a new task with comprehensive properties.
**Parameters:**
- `content` (required): Task title
- `description` (optional): Task description
- `project_id` (optional): Project ID
- `section_id` (optional): Section ID
- `parent_id` (optional): Parent task ID for subtasks
- `priority` (optional): 1-4, where 4 is urgent
- `labels` (optional): Array of label names
- `due_string` (optional): Natural language due date (e.g., "tomorrow at 14:00")
- `due_date` (optional): YYYY-MM-DD format
- `due_datetime` (optional): RFC3339 format
- `due_lang` (optional): Language for parsing due_string
- `assignee_id` (optional): User ID to assign
- `duration` (optional): Duration amount
- `duration_unit` (optional): "minute" or "day"
**Example:**
```json
{
"content": "Buy groceries",
"description": "Milk, eggs, bread",
"priority": 3,
"labels": ["shopping", "urgent"],
"due_string": "tomorrow at 14:00"
}
```
#### `update_task`
Update an existing task.
**Parameters:**
- `task_id` (required): Task ID
- All other parameters from `create_task` (optional)
#### `complete_task`
Mark a task as complete. Recurring tasks move to next occurrence.
**Parameters:**
- `task_id` (required): Task ID
#### `reopen_task`
Reopen a completed task.
**Parameters:**
- `task_id` (required): Task ID
#### `delete_task`
Permanently delete a task.
**Parameters:**
- `task_id` (required): Task ID
### Project Management
#### `list_projects`
Get all projects.
#### `get_project`
Get a single project by ID.
**Parameters:**
- `project_id` (required): Project ID
#### `create_project`
Create a new project.
**Parameters:**
- `name` (required): Project name
- `parent_id` (optional): Parent project ID for nested projects
- `color` (optional): Color name (e.g., "blue", "red")
- `is_favorite` (optional): Boolean
- `view_style` (optional): "list" or "board"
#### `update_project`
Update an existing project.
**Parameters:**
- `project_id` (required): Project ID
- All other parameters from `create_project` (optional)
#### `delete_project`
Permanently delete a project and all its tasks.
**Parameters:**
- `project_id` (required): Project ID
### Label Management
#### `list_labels`
Get all labels.
#### `get_label`
Get a single label by ID.
**Parameters:**
- `label_id` (required): Label ID
#### `create_label`
Create a new label.
**Parameters:**
- `name` (required): Label name
- `color` (optional): Color name
- `order` (optional): Position in list
- `is_favorite` (optional): Boolean
#### `update_label`
Update an existing label.
**Parameters:**
- `label_id` (required): Label ID
- All other parameters from `create_label` (optional)
#### `delete_label`
Permanently delete a label.
**Parameters:**
- `label_id` (required): Label ID
### Section Management
#### `list_sections`
Get all sections, optionally filtered by project.
**Parameters:**
- `project_id` (optional): Project ID
#### `get_section`
Get a single section by ID.
**Parameters:**
- `section_id` (required): Section ID
#### `create_section`
Create a new section.
**Parameters:**
- `name` (required): Section name
- `project_id` (required): Project ID
- `order` (optional): Position in project
#### `update_section`
Update an existing section.
**Parameters:**
- `section_id` (required): Section ID
- `name` (required): New section name
#### `delete_section`
Delete a section (tasks are not deleted).
**Parameters:**
- `section_id` (required): Section ID
### Comment Management
#### `list_comments`
Get comments for a task or project.
**Parameters:**
- `task_id` (optional): Task ID
- `project_id` (optional): Project ID
#### `get_comment`
Get a single comment by ID.
**Parameters:**
- `comment_id` (required): Comment ID
#### `create_comment`
Create a new comment.
**Parameters:**
- `content` (required): Comment text
- `task_id` (optional): Task ID
- `project_id` (optional): Project ID
- `attachment` (optional): File attachment object
#### `update_comment`
Update an existing comment.
**Parameters:**
- `comment_id` (required): Comment ID
- `content` (required): Updated comment text
#### `delete_comment`
Permanently delete a comment.
**Parameters:**
- `comment_id` (required): Comment ID

## Rate Limits
The Todoist API has the following rate limits:
- 450 requests per 15 minutes per user
The server automatically tracks requests and throws an error if the limit is exceeded.
## Error Handling
All tools provide meaningful error messages when operations fail. Common errors include:
- Missing or invalid API token
- Rate limit exceeded
- Invalid task/project/label IDs
- Invalid parameter values
